"Among the Celtic people of Ireland and the norhwest of Scotland story-telling has alwasy been a favourite amusement." Calling on a deep-rooted tradition of story-telling the Irish historian and etymologist Patrick Weston Joyce 1827-1914 presents the first full collection of the old Gaelic prose romances in the English language full of ancient tales of giants and swan-children and mermaids mysterious witches wise druids magical fawns cursed warriors and treacherous fae. Clad here in admittedly worn but steadfast deep red with Celtic knots stamped in black you'll find many fabled stories from Irish myth legend epic and echtra: The Children of Lyr The Legend of Lough Neagh and Liban the Mermaid The Adventure of Connla of the Golden Hair and the Fairy Maiden The Voyage of Máel Dúin the heroic Fenian Cycle and more.<br /> <br /> <br /> 7 1/8" X 5". xx 474pp plus four pages of ads for other works by the author.
